Staying informed without being overwhelmed is the key to an efficient support operation. FusionDesk gives you granular control over how and when you receive alerts — from a ticket being assigned to you, to an SLA breach approaching for a critical customer. You can configure notifications at the personal level and, if you’re an admin, set rules that apply across your entire team.

Notification Types

FusionDesk delivers alerts through three channels, each suited to different working styles and urgency levels:

Email

Notifications are sent to your registered email address. Ideal for asynchronous teams or when you need a searchable paper trail of alerts.

In-App

Alerts appear in the notification bell (top-right corner) while you are logged in to FusionDesk. Unread counts persist until you dismiss them.

Mobile Push

Push notifications delivered to the FusionDesk mobile app on iOS or Android. Best for on-call agents who need real-time alerts away from their desk.
Each notification type can be enabled or disabled independently per event, so you can, for example, receive in-app alerts for every comment but only email notifications for SLA breaches.

Configuring Personal Notification Preferences

1

Open your profile menu

Click your avatar in the top-right corner of the FusionDesk interface, then select Notification Preferences from the dropdown.
2

Review the event list

You will see a list of all trackable events grouped into categories: Tickets, Tasks, and Mentions. Each row represents one event type.
3

Toggle channels for each event

For each event, use the toggle switches under the Email, In-App, and Push columns to enable or disable that channel. Changes save automatically as you toggle.
4

Set notification frequency for email

For email notifications, choose between Instant (sent immediately when the event occurs) and Digest (bundled into a single email sent at intervals you choose — hourly or end-of-day).
5

Save and confirm

Click Save Preferences. A confirmation banner appears at the top of the page. Your new settings take effect immediately.

Setting Up Team-Level Notification Rules

Administrators can define notification rules that apply to all agents in a group, ensuring that critical events are never missed regardless of individual preference settings. To configure team-level rules:
  1. Navigate to SettingsNotificationsTeam Rules.
  2. Click + New Rule.
  3. Select the Group or Department the rule applies to.
  4. Choose the event that triggers the notification.
  5. Select the delivery channel and the recipients (all group members, group lead only, or a specific agent).
  6. Set any conditions — for example, only fire when ticket priority is High or Urgent.
  7. Click Save Rule.
Team-level rules run in addition to individual preferences. If a rule fires for an agent who has also configured a personal preference for the same event, they may receive alerts on both channels unless you check the Override personal preferences box when creating the rule.

FusionDesk applies a rate limit to email notifications to prevent alert fatigue. If more than 10 email notifications are triggered for the same ticket within a 15-minute window, subsequent alerts are bundled into a single digest email rather than sent individually. This limit does not apply to in-app or push notifications. You can adjust the bundling threshold in SettingsNotificationsRate Limiting.
